Default Speedometer cable with Mitchell OD

I just put a Mitchell OD in my A purchased used from a barner. It was a complete rear end from a 31. Works great!! The only issue is the early oval speedometer cable I have doesn't fit the square cable on the Mitchell. Mitchell is closed already so just wondering if a square-square 31 cable from Snyder's will work on my oval speedo(square-keyed).

Default Re: Speedometer cable with Mitchell OD

I think that you either need a "special cable" from Snyders that is oval speedometer size ( 0.124 ) on the top and 30-31 sized ( 0.104 ) on the bottom, or get a oval speedometer version cable extension from Mitchell. The top end square drive that goes into the speedometer head is larger on the oval speedometer than the round faced. ( 0.124 vs 0.104 )
